A reliable technique for remaining useful life estimation of rolling element bearings using dynamic regression models |
Abstract | ||
---|---|---|
•This paper proposes a reliable technique for the health prognosis of rolling element bearings.•The proposed algorithm is tested and validated on the PRONOSTIA dataset.•The proposed method shows the excellent prognostic performance. |
